    Getting There

    Car

    If you're traveling by car, head towards Seltjarnarnes from wherever you are in the Southern Peninsula. From Reykjavík, take Route 41 towards Keflavik, and then merge onto Route 43 towards Seltjarnarnes. Continue on Route 43 until you reach the Unnamed Road. Follow the road towards the coast, where you will find Suðurnesvarða. There is no fee for parking in the area.

    Public Transportation

    To reach Suðurnesvarða by public transportation, take the bus from Reykjavík to Seltjarnarnes. Look for bus line S1 or S2, which run regularly from the main bus station in Reykjavík. Get off at the Seltjarnarnes stop and walk towards the coast. It is about a 15-minute walk from the bus stop to Suðurnesvarða. Ensure you check the bus schedules in advance as they may vary depending on the day.

    Walking

    If you're already in Seltjarnarnes, you can simply walk to Suðurnesvarða. From the main square (Seltjarnarnes Torg), head towards the coast and follow the path along the shoreline. It is a pleasant walk, taking about 20-30 minutes depending on your pace.

    Local tips

    Visit during sunrise or sunset for the best lighting and fewer crowds.
    Bring a camera to capture the stunning landscapes and natural beauty.
    Wear comfortable walking shoes to explore the various paths around the area.
    Check local weather conditions before your visit, as Icelandic weather can change rapidly.
